thin-film transistor in Greek

thin-film transistor in Greek is ΔΛΜ, Διαντιστάτης Λεπτής Μεμβράνης.

thin-film transistor in Greek

ΔΛΜ
noun
Pronounced: DLM
A form of transistor manufactured by depositing layers of semiconductor, dielectric and metal on a substrate
Διαντιστάτης Λεπτής Μεμβράνης
noun
Pronounced: Diadistatis Leptis Memvranis
A form of transistor manufactured by depositing layers of semiconductor, dielectric and metal on a substrate
